DS89C430/DS89C440/DS89C450
Ultra-High-Speed Flash Microcontrollers
www.maxim-ic.com
GENERAL DESCRIPTION
FEATURES
Cꢀ High-Speed 8051 Architecture
One Clock-Per-Machine Cycle
The DS89C430, DS89C440, and DS89C450 offer the
highest performance available in 8051-compatible
microcontrollers. They feature newly designed
processor cores that execute instructions up to 12
times faster than the original 8051 at the same
crystal speed. Typical applications will experience a
DC to 33MHz Operation
Single Cycle Instruction in 30ns
Optional Variable Length MOVX to Access
Fast/Slow Peripherals
Dual Data Pointers with Automatic
Increment/Decrement and Toggle Select
Supports Four Paged Memory-Access Modes
speed improvement up to 10x. At
1 million
instructions per second (MIPS) per megahertz, the
microcontrollers achieve 33 MIPS performance from
a maximum 33MHz clock rate.
Cꢀ On-Chip Memory
16kB/32kB/64kB Flash Memory
In-Application Programmable
In-System Programmable Through Serial Port
1kB SRAM for MOVX
The Ultra-High-Speed Flash Microcontroller Userís Guide should
be used in conjunction with this data sheet. Download it at
www.maxim-ic.com/microcontrollers.
ORDERING INFORMATION
Cꢀ 80C52 Compatible
FLASH
8051 Pin and Instruction Set Compatible
Four Bidirectional, 8-Bit I/O Ports
Three 16-Bit Timer Counters
256 Bytes Scratchpad RAM
PART
PIN-PACKAGE
MEMORY SIZE
16kB
DS89C430-MNL
DS89C430-MNL+
DS89C430-QNL
DS89C430-QNL+
DS89C430-ENL
DS89C430-ENL+
DS89C440-MNL
DS89C440-MNL+
DS89C440-QNL
DS89C440-QNL+
DS89C440-ENL
DS89C440-ENL
DS89C450-MNL
DS89C450-MNL+
DS89C450-QNL
DS89C450-QNL+
DS89C450-ENL
DS89C450-ENL+
40 PDIP
40 PDIP
44 PLCC
44 PLCC
44 TQFP
44 TQFP
40 PDIP
40 PDIP
44 PLCC
44 PLCC
44 TQFP
44 TQFP
40 PDIP
40 PDIP
44 PLCC
44 PLCC
44 TQFP
44 TQFP
16kB
16kB
Cꢀ Power-Management Mode
16kB
16kB
Programmable Clock Divider
16kB
Automatic Hardware and Software Exit
32kB
Cꢀ ROMSIZE Feature
32kB
Selects Internal Program Memory Size from
0 to 64kB
32kB
32kB
Allows Access to Entire External Memory Map
32kB
Dynamically Adjustable by Software
32kB
64kB
Cꢀ Peripheral Features
64kB
Two Full-Duplex Serial Ports
Programmable Watchdog Timer
13 Interrupt Sources (Six External)
Five Levels of Interrupt Priority
Power-Fail Reset
64kB
64kB
64kB
64kB
+ Denotes a lead-free/RoHS-compliant device.
Early Warning Power-Fail Interrupt
Electromagnetic Interference (EMI) Reduction
Complete Selector Guide appears at end of data sheet.
Pin Configurations appear at end of data sheet.
APPLICATIONS
Data Logging
Telephones
Building Energy
Control and
Uninterruptible
Automotive Text Industrial Control
Power Supplies
Equipment
and Automation
Management
White Goods
Motor Control
HVAC
Vending
Programmable
Building Security
Consumer
Logic Controllers
and Door Access Electronics
Control
Magstripe
Gaming
Reader/Scanner
Equipment
Note: Some revisions of this device may incorporate deviations from published specifications known as errata. Multiple revisions of any device
may be simultaneously available through various sales channels. For information about device errata, click here: www.maxim-ic.com/errata.
1 of 48
REV: 060805